Toxic Masculinity. How much of the world's suffering is caused by men trying to puff themselves up to seem like tough, strong, and powerful. Putin, Trump, Will Smith? Susan and Art have a lively discussion about this worldwide problem and what can be done about it. Why is it that men are only allowed to show their emotions through anger, pride, and isolation? In this episode we start with a few final thoughts about Will Smith and move on to Louis C.K. and other poor examples of masculinity. Art gives his ideas about what a real man should look like and Susan talks about how difficult it is for a woman in a world so dominated by male toxicity.
